I run a lincoln and a 2970 (old style) side by side on a daily basis. and can say I like them both. If you only use ssb. the lincoln is great but if you want a great am rig the 2970 or 2950 will blow the lincoln away. If you want swing its a no brainer old style red display 2970 or 2950. This is not to say that the 2950 or 2970 havent been mistaken for a kenwood or some other high end rig on ssb. I'm not bashing the lincoln but if I could only have one the 2970 is more versatile. luckly I'm not left with that choice and own and use the both.
